The Annual Review of Medicine is a peer-reviewed medical journal that publishes review articles about all aspects of medicine. It was established in 1950. Its longest-serving editors have been William P. Creger (1974–1993) and C. Thomas Caskey (2001–2019). The current editor is Mary E. Klotman. As of 2023, Annual Review of Medicine is being published as open access, under the Subscribe to Open model.[1] As of 2023, Journal Citation Reports gives the journal a 2022 impact factor of 10.5, ranking it sixteenth of 136 titles in the category "Medicine, Research & Experimental".[2]

History[edit]

The first volume of the journal was published in 1950 by the nonprofit publishing company Annual Reviews. It noted that the more "active" areas of medicine would be covered in each volume, while other subdisciplines would be covered every two or three years.[3] Its first editor was Windsor C. Cutting.[4] In 1996, it was one of the first Annual Reviews journals to be published electronically.[5]

Editors of volumes[edit]

Dates indicate publication years in which someone was credited as a lead editor or co-editor of a journal volume. The planning process for a volume begins well before the volume appears, so appointment to the position of lead editor generally occurred prior to the first year shown here. An editor who has retired or died may be credited as a lead editor of a volume that they helped to plan, even if it is published after their retirement or death.

  • David A. Rytand (1955–1963)[6]
  • Arthur C. DeGraff (1964–1973)[7]
  • William P. Creger (1974–1993)[8]
  • Cecil H. Coggins (1994–2000)[9]
  • C. Thomas Caskey (2001–2019)[10][11]
  • Mary E. Klotman (2020–present)[12]
